U MAC verzijama znamo da je alat Disk Utility nam je omogućio da izvršimo analizu diskova ili diska koje imamo u svom sustavu u potrazi za pogreškama ili greškama, posebno na razini dopuštenja koja može utjecati na performanse operacijskog sustava MAC. Istina je da je u najnovijim verzijama MAC -a, poput OS X El Capitan ili Yosemite, ova funkcija uklonjena. Čak i u tom slučaju možemo provesti analizu i odgovarajuću korekciju dopuštenja putem terminala. Evo kako to učiniti.
U ovoj studiji ćemo vidjeti kako provjeriti i popraviti dozvole u OS X El Capitan okruženju. Dopuštenja su u osnovi parametri datoteke koji značajno utječu na njenu izvedbu jer je ne možemo pročitati, otvoriti, urediti itd., A to može utjecati na softver koji je pokreće.
Klase dopuštenja na Macu
- ACL: Kontrola korisničkog pristupa
- UNIX dopuštenja
Korak 1
Prvo što moramo učiniti za početak procesa je otvoriti Mac Terminal
Otvorite Mac Terminal
- Prikažite gornji izbornik, odaberite Uslužni programi i tamo odaberite Terminal
- Idite u gornji desni kut i u ikonu povećala unesite riječ Terminal i odaberite opciju Terminal
Nakon što otvorimo terminal, moramo unijeti sljedeću naredbu za izvršavanje odgovarajuće provjere dopuštenja MAC -a:
sudo / usr / libexec / repair_packages --verify --standard-pkgs /BilješkaAko moramo navesti dopuštenja za određenu jedinicu, moramo zamijeniti / simbol.
Možemo primijetiti da će se nakon izvršavanja naredbe prikazati slični podaci:
Dopuštenja se razlikuju za "usr / libexec / cup / cgi-bin", trebaju biti drwxr-xr-x, to su dr-xr-xr-x. Dopuštenja se razlikuju za "usr / libexec / cup / daemon", treba biti drwxr- xr-x, oni su dr-xr-xr-x.
POVEĆAJTE
Na taj način možemo promatrati dopuštenja koja predstavljaju neku vrstu pogreške u OS X El Capitan.
Korak 2
Nakon što potvrdimo da imamo pogreške u dopuštenjima, nastavit ćemo s odgovarajućim popravkom, za to ćemo unijeti sljedeću naredbu:
sudo / usr / libexec / repair_packages --repair --standard-pkgs --volume /S prethodnom naredbom smo naznačavajući sustavu da popravi dopuštenja koja predstavljaju neku vrstu pogreške. Ovaj proces može potrajati isto kao što se događa s alatom Disk Utility, ali na kraju ćemo vidjeti ispravljene pakete na ispravan način.
POVEĆAJTE
Korak 3
Važno je to zapamtiti Moramo pripremiti sudo za izvršavanje zadatka s root dopuštenjima, jer ako ne postavimo sudo, jednostavno će se prikazati izbornik pomoći repair_packages. Na primjer, ako unesemo samo izraz:
/ usr / libexec / repair_packagesVidjet ćemo što je prikazano na sljedećoj slici:
Ovako možemo pokrenuti analizu dopuštenja koja mogu biti neispravna u našem MAC sustavu i moći ih popraviti radi poboljšanja performansi i dostupnosti njih koristeći ove jednostavne naredbe. Upamtite da ovo nije zadatak koji se događa svakodnevno ili stalno, ali dobro je da imamo znanje o tim pogreškama.